Noun [Dutch]

IPA: /ˈkneː.kəlˌɦœy̯s/ Audio: Nl-knekelhuis.ogg Forms: knekelhuizen [plural], knekelhuisje [diminutive, neuter]
Etymology: Compound of knekel (“bone”) + huis (“house”). Etymology templates: {{compound|nl|knekel|huis|t1=bone|t2=house}} knekel (“bone”) + huis (“house”) Head templates: {{nl-noun|n|-zen|+}} knekelhuis n (plural knekelhuizen, diminutive knekelhuisje n)
  1. building where disinterred (human) bones are stored, usually at a cemetery; bonehouse, charnel house Tags: neuter Categories (topical): Burial Synonyms: beenderhuis, krekelhuis (alt: Noord-Brabant) [dialectal]
